Tek Seng Holdings Bhd (7200) - Total Liabilities

Latest as of June 2026: RM44.89 Million MYR ≈ $11.27 Million USD

Based on the latest financial reports, Tek Seng Holdings Bhd (7200) has total liabilities worth RM44.89 Million MYR (≈ $11.27 Million USD) as of June 2026. Total liabilities represent everything the company owes to external parties, combining both current liabilities—like accounts payable, short-term debt, and accrued expenses—and non-current liabilities such as long-term debt, pension obligations, lease liabilities, and deferred tax liabilities. Liquidity & Leverage Metrics

Key Metrics Explained

Metric Value Description
Current Ratio 3.27 Measures ability to pay short-term obligations (Current Assets ÷ Current Liabilities)
Quick Ratio N/A More stringent measure of short-term liquidity ((Current Assets - Inventory) ÷ Current Liabilities)
Cash Ratio N/A Most conservative liquidity measure (Cash & Equivalents ÷ Current Liabilities)
Debt to Equity 0.18 Measures financial leverage (Total Liabilities ÷ Shareholder Equity)
Debt to Assets 0.13 Portion of assets financed with debt (Total Liabilities ÷ Total Assets)

Annual Total Liabilities for Tek Seng Holdings Bhd (2012–2025)

The table below shows the annual total liabilities of Tek Seng Holdings Bhd from 2012 to 2025.

Year Total Liabilities Change
2025-12-31 RM48.60 Million
≈ $12.20 Million
-51.24%
2024-12-31 RM99.66 Million
≈ $25.02 Million
+5.24%
2023-12-31 RM94.70 Million
≈ $23.78 Million
+5.27%
2022-12-31 RM89.96 Million
≈ $22.59 Million
-2.00%
2021-12-31 RM91.79 Million
≈ $23.05 Million
-0.78%
2020-12-31 RM92.51 Million
≈ $23.23 Million
-1.21%
2019-12-31 RM93.65 Million
≈ $23.51 Million
-10.66%
2018-12-31 RM104.82 Million
≈ $26.32 Million
-41.73%
2017-12-31 RM179.89 Million
≈ $45.16 Million
-41.51%
2016-12-31 RM307.56 Million
≈ $77.22 Million
+62.73%
2015-12-31 RM189.00 Million
≈ $47.45 Million
+35.00%
2014-12-31 RM140.00 Million
≈ $35.15 Million
+13.82%
2013-12-31 RM123.00 Million
≈ $30.88 Million
+1.65%
2012-12-31 RM121.00 Million
≈ $30.38 Million
--

About

Tek Seng Holdings Berhad, an investment holding company, manufactures and trades in polyvinyl chloride (PVC) related products and polypropylene (PP) non-woven products. It operates through three segments: Polyvinyl Chloride, Photovoltaic Solar, and Property Investment.
